In 1588 the seemingly invincible Spanish Armada failed to defeat the English navy, while at the same time, her New World possessions had been repeatedly attacked by English ships led, more often than not, by Sir Francis Drake (1540?-1596). After three centuries of colonial rule, independence came rather suddenly to most of Spanish and Portuguese America. The military has a prominence in most of them that is almost unique among the world's democracies, and Latin American politics and government are still strongly reminiscent of the Spanish feudal heritage, in which a strong leader dominated the nation's political machinery. Spain's recent emergence from seven centuries of Moorish rule had only served to emphasize to her the importance of the Christian Church (this was before the Protestant Reformation), and religious belief was an important fact of daily life. Although the Alexandrine Bulls gave full, free and omnipotent power to the Catholic Monarchs,[76] they did not rule them as a private property but as a public property through the public bodies and authorities from Castile,[77] and when those territories were incorporated into the Crown of Castile the royal power was subject to the laws of Castile. [29] Spain was largely able to defend its territories in the Americas, with the Dutch, English, and French taking only small Caribbean islands and outposts, using them to engage in contraband trade with the Spanish populace in the Indies.
